Registering with the surgery
To register with the surgery:
- visit reception when we are open and collect a paper registration form
- use your Patient Access account (on the Patient Access website or in the Patient Access app)
- use your NHS account (through the NHS website or NHS App)
- email the practice on nhsnwl.patientssmc@nhs.net
- phone the practice on 020 8427 7172, when we are open.
When you register, it’s helpful to have your NHS number. You can use the NHS website to find your NHS number.
Named GP
All patients at Savita Medical Centre have a named, accountable doctor who is responsible for coordinating their care.
Your named doctor will be allocated to you by the practice. You can still talk to or make appointments to see any of our doctors or nurses, not just your named GP.
If you have a preference and would like to request a particular doctor at the practice to be your named GP please talk to one of our receptionists.
